#fbb297 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fbb297 is composed of 98.4% red, 69.8%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.1% magenta, 39.8%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 16.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 78.8%. #fbb297 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f7652f.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#fbb297 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fbb297 has RGB values of R:251, G:178,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.4,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16495255.

Shades and Tints of #fbb297
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090300 is the darkest color, while #fff8f5 is the lightest one.
